Country-Ham Potato Soup
Yield: 4 servings Preparation: 15 minutes Cook: 30 minutes 1/4 cup butter 1-1/2 cups chopped onion 1 tablespoon minced garlic 1 cup chopped country ham 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our 3 cups chicken broth 4 cups unpeeled, chopped new potatoes 1-1/2 cups heavy cream 2 teaspoons fresh chopped thyme 1/2 teaspoon red pepper flakes 1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per 1 cup shredded sharp Cheddar cheese 1/2 cup sour cream Garnish: additional chopped country ham In a large stockpot, over medium-high heat, melt butter. Add onion, garlic, and ham; cook for approximately 4 minutes, or until onion is soft and ham begins to brown. Add flour and stir for approximately 1 minute, or until well blended. Add broth and stir; cook until thickened and bubbly. Add potatoes; bring to a simmer. Reduce heat to medium-low, cover, and cook for 15 minutes, or until potatoes are tender. With a potato masher, mash potatoes until only a few chunks remain. Add cream, thyme, red pepper flakes, and black pepper; cook for 2 minutes. Stir in cheese and sour cream until well blended. Garnish with additional chopped country ham, if desired. |
